The cheapest way to get from Avignon to Meynes is to line 115 bus and line 125 bus which costs €4 and takes 1h 42m.
The fastest way to get from Avignon to Meynes is to taxi which takes 33 min and costs €55 - €70.
No, there is no direct bus from Avignon to Meynes. However, there are services departing from Avignon - Pem and arriving at MEYNES - Mairie via ESTÉZARGUES - La Queyrade.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 42m.
The distance between Avignon and Meynes is 48 km. The road distance is 25.3 km.
The best way to get from Avignon to Meynes without a car is to train and taxi which takes 40 min and costs €30 - €45.
It takes approximately 40 min to get from Avignon to Meynes, including transfers.
